Why Kansas State is a good bet at +16?
If not for a 10-31 loss to Mississippi State, Kansas State might be undefeated this season. The Wildcats beat South Dakota State 27-24 in Week 1 before dominating Texas-San Antonio 41-17 in Week 3. K-State’s offense found a rhythm in the victory over the UTSA Road Runners, notching 449 total yards. The 449 total yards included 164 rushing yards. If K-State’s offense gets into a rhythm on Saturday, it could stick with the Mountaineers’ offense.Team Statistics

NCAA Football Betting Trends for Kansas State at #13 West Virginia
- Kansas State is 4-1 SU in the last 5 games on the road
- Kansas State is 5-1 ATS in the last 6 games when playing West Virginia
- The total went UNDER in 5 of Kansas State’s last 5 games when playing West Virginia
- West Virginia is 5-10 ATS in the last 15 games at home
- West Virginia is 15-4 SU in the last 19 games at home
- The total went UNDER in 5 of West Virginia’s last 5 games when playing Kansas State
